2 November 2013 Volume 1, No. 1 History Initiative of the Information Centre of AEBR in Simon Kuznets Kharkiv National University of Economics NGO Euroregion Slobozhanschyna and Kharkiv National University of Economics initiated the establishment of the Information Center of the Association of European Border Regions. Kharkiv Regional State Administration held it this initiative (letter to the Department of Economics and International Relations of HOAG from , 12-13/212.). Creation of Information Center of AEBR was included in the work plan of the Board and the Secretariat of the Ukrainian Association of district and regional councils in The Secretary-General Martín Guillermo-Ramírez March 31, 2013 The Secretary-General Martin Guillermo Ramirez sent a letter to the leadership of Euroregion Slobozhanschyna in which he reported on the support of the initiatives of the Information Center of AEBR on the basis of Kharkiv National University of Economics and initiative to create Ukrainian Euroregional group on cooperation with AEBR. April 3, 2013 in Kharkov, on behalf of the Secretary- General of AEBR Martin Guillermo Ramirez had a meeting with Mr. Alfred Evers, on the activities of the Euroregion Slobozhanschyna and the opening of the Information Center of AEBR in the Library building of Kharkiv National University of Economics. This initiative NGO Euroregion Slobozhanschyna and Kharkiv National University of Economics was considered and supported through the work of the General Assembly AEBR in Berlin on 7-8 November 2012 and at a meeting of the Executive Committee of the AEBR in Santiago de Compostela March 8, In January and February 2013, two meetings at the level of representatives of Kharkiv Regional State Administration, Kharkiv National University of Economics and NGO Euroregion Slobozhanschyna on the opening of the Information Center of AEBR. Beginning Presentation of the launch of the Information Center of AEBR on the basis of Kharkiv National University of Economics, was presented at a meeting of the Executive Committee of the AEBR in Santiago de Compostela March 8, In preparing this presentation was attended by representatives of Kharkiv National University of Economics, NGO Euroregion Slobozhanschyna, the secretariat of the Ukrainian Association of district and regional councils, the Department of Economics and International Relations of Kharkiv Regional State Administration. 3 Visit to Kharkov Cooperation During the III International Forum Ukraine EU: a new level of cooperation, which was held in Kharkov May 25, 2013 held a video conference with the participation of the Secretary General of the Association of European Border Regions Martin Guillermo Ramirez. Martin Guillermo Ramirez,the Secretary-General of the Association of European Border Regions (AEBR ) visited Kharkiv region on working purposes from November 12th to 14th. The Secretary-General of AEBR Martin Guillermo Ramirez confirmed the intention to create an information center in Kharkov of AEBR based Kharkiv National University of Economics. The idea of the International Center of AEBR supported the Association of Local Self-Government Euroregion Carpathian and Association of Council of Municipalities of the Belgorod region. NGO Euroregion Slobozhanschyna and Kharkiv National University of Economics initiated for November 12-14, 2013 celebrations to mark the opening of the Information Center of AEBR in Kharkov. As a part of the Days of crossborder cooperation. Euroregion Slobozhanschina on November 12, 2013 in Simon Kuznets Kharkiv National University of Economics the Secretary- General of Association of European Border Regions Martin Guillermo Ramirez, vicerector of Simon Kuznets Kharkiv National University of Economics Mykola Afanasiev and the president of Kharkiv NGO Euroregion Slobozhanschina Eduard Syromolot signed an agreement on the establishment of the Information Centre of the Association of European Border Regions at Simon Kuznets Kharkiv National University of Economics. Main objective of an Information Center in AEBR at Simon Kuznets Kharkiv National University of Economics: - coordination of cooperation between European border regions of Ukraine, Russia and the European Union; - the development of the Ukrainian- Russian border cooperation ; - the establishment and implementation of cross-border cooperation projects ; - strengthening the role of local communities in the development of crossborder cooperation ; - promotion of the Euroregion Slobozhanshina. 5 Declaration of Days of transborder cooperation. Euroregion Slobozhanschina 2013 We, the representatives of the Association of European Border Regions of Simon Kuznets Kharkiv National University of Economics, Kharkiv NGO Euroregion Slobozhanshina - the founders of the Information Center of the Association of European Border Regions in Simon Kuznets Kharkiv National University of Economics, following the results of the meetings of Communication Group of Information Center of the Association of European Border Regions in Simon Kuznets Kharkiv National University of Economics and work meetings with representatives of local authorities of Kharkiv region from 12 to 14 November 2013 noted the following. The implementation of a joint initiative by the Information Center of the Association of European Border Regions in Simon Kuznets Kharkiv National University of Economics was made possible due to the establishment of important communications with the Association of European Border Regions. On November 12, 2013 the Information Center of the Association of European Border Regions in Simon Kuznets Kharkiv National University of Economics was opened. From November 12 to November 14 of 2013 work meetings and important communications related to the opening of the Information Center of the Association of European Border Regions in Simon Kuznets Kharkiv National University of Economics were held. It has been 55 years since the creation of the first Euroregion Euroregion and today we can talk about the efficiency and effectiveness of the integration of such a small form as a small model of territorial development of all countries of Europe. In turn, the Euroregions are effective tools for enhancing the capacity of border regions of neighboring countries and a platform for the development of new strategies for inter-territorial cross-border cooperation. A very important development direction of Euroregional cooperation could be the creation of Euroregional cooperation group with AEBR and Ukrainian- Russian network of Euroregions. The establishment of urban and rural areas integrated in the Euroregion Slobozhanshina will serve as a starting point for the formation of new strategies for the development of Euroregional cooperation between Kharkov and Belgorod regions. Relevant is the continuation of the work in the Euroregion Slobozhanshina on the formation of multi- municipal cooperation. One of the main priorities of the agenda of Euroregional development is the activation of cross-border cooperation of territorial communities and the inclusion of the capacity of higher education institutions to create projects of development of territories. Creating an Information Center of the Association of European Border Regions in Simon Kuznets Kharkiv National University of Economics is one of the most important stages in the formation of the space Euroregional cooperation in Ukraine. Information Centre of the Association of European Border Regions in Simon Kuznets Kharkiv National University of Economics will deal with informing of local authorities of border areas and all interested parties on the programs of cross-border cooperation.
